Student SupportDisability StatementThe College recognises that it has clear obligations towards all its students to ensure that they are all afforded the opportunity to realise their full potential. The College tries to anticipate the needs of all students who join College with a disability, or who develop a disability, physical or mental, during their course of study. The aim is that no one should be disadvantaged in any way. If you have a disability, or have special requirements, please inform us as soon as possible. This can be done on your written application or at your Year 11 interview. We rely on you to tell us what you need. This will give us time to check that we can meet your needs or, if not, to make sure that suitable provision is in place by the time you arrive in September. Once you are a College student you should keep your Personal Tutor informed as to whether what we are providing is appropriate. A termly review of your needs will be held.
